French striker Kylian Mbappe is set to announce his future plans in the coming days after winning the French Cup with PSG on Saturday. The 25-year-old, who scored 256 goals in 307 games for PSG, has decided not to extend his contract with the club, which expires this summer.

Mbappe was tight-lipped about his next move after beating Lyon 2-1 in the final, but he later confirmed that he would be joining Real Madrid as a free agent this summer. The announcement of his new club is expected to come before the UEFA 2024 Euro that starts on June 14.

Looking back on his time with PSG, Mbappe expressed gratitude for the unique experience and stated that playing for the team was something he would always recommend and cherish. However, he is now ready for a new chapter that he believes will be equally magical.

Mbappe’s decision to join Real Madrid comes after rejecting previous offers from the club in the summers of 2021 and 2022. The long-anticipated partnership between Mbappe and Real Madrid is finally set to begin, bringing an exciting new chapter in Mbappe’s career.
